Technical Innovation Highlights
The innovative design achieves remarkable protection levels of 6KV common mode and 2KV differential mode surge protection, complying with IEC61000-4-5 and GB17626.5 standards. This advancement significantly enhances the reliability of industrial communication systems in harsh electromagnetic environments.
Key Design Features
- Advanced three-tier protection system incorporating gas discharge tubes, PTC thermistors, and TSS devices
- Optimized PCB layout ensuring compact placement of protective and filtering components
- Sophisticated ground isolation design to minimize EMC risks
- Implementation of common-mode inductors with impedance ranging from 120Ω to 2200Ω at 100MHz
